JoeN, I would contact Magico. I have had lots of experience with subs. As far as integration I believe you will experience significant problems because of the size of your woofers. Have you considered the crossover frequency between you new subs and your mains? None of these subs will be as quick as your mains. The higher the crossover frequency the more apparent this will be. Your bass will be different but will it be the bass you have now? Unless you are dissatisfied with it, wait until your new room when you will have more space, then add Magico Q-subs which will provide you bass as quick as you have now.
